Menopause Hormones Profile - Monitor Your Hormonal Health in Epsom

The Menopause Hormones Profile is designed to provide a comprehensive analysis of your hormonal health during menopause. This test measures critical hormones such as Follicular Stimulating Hormone (FSH), Luteinizing Hormone (LH), Oestradiol (E2), and Testosterone, which fluctuate during menopause and can significantly affect your health, mood, and well-being.

Why Choose the Menopause Hormones Profile in Epsom?

Menopause can bring a variety of symptoms, including hot flashes, mood swings, and fatigue. The Menopause Hormones Profile is essential for women in Epsom who are experiencing menopause or perimenopause, helping to monitor key hormone levels and assess whether any imbalances are contributing to these symptoms. By understanding your hormonal levels, you can make informed decisions about treatment, lifestyle changes, and overall health management.

This test includes the measurement of:

  • Follicular Stimulating Hormone (FSH): A key hormone that plays a major role in regulating the menstrual cycle and fertility.

  • Luteinizing Hormone (LH): Works alongside FSH and is crucial in the reproductive cycle.

  • Oestradiol (E2): The primary form of estrogen in the body, critical for regulating many bodily functions during menopause.

  • Testosterone: A hormone that can influence energy levels, mood, and libido during menopause.

  • Thyroid Stimulating Hormone (TSH): Helps assess thyroid function, as thyroid imbalances can mimic symptoms of menopause.
